Prime Minister Dahal takes stock of President Paudel’s health condition
The head of the state is receiving treatment at TU Teaching Hospital for an abdomen-related ailment.

Kathmandu
Prime Minister Pushpa Kamal Dahal on Sunday took stock of the health condition of President Ramchandra Paudel.
The prime minister visited the ailing president at Tribhuvan University Teaching Hospital and wished him a speedy recovery, according to Ramesh Malla, an aide to the prime minister.
President Paudel was admitted to the Maharajgunj-based hospital on Saturday evening after he complained of a problem in his abdomen.
Suresh Chalise, the principal adviser to the president, said Paudel had complained of acute pain in his stomach.
Meanwhile, the hospital in a statement said the health condition of the president is improving.
